Leaving the o2 sensor out of its bung or unplugged is bad.

And you contradicted yourself there


and trust me, im not a follower.
i got the plugs cause it was a suggestion that i got them,
Ahem.

You want to run the hottest possible plug you can without knocking. Too cold with too much air coming in will blow the spark out.

Too hot of a plug will cause detonation.

Also you know L61 cranks are just plain Jane steel? They are not forged.
